When an accident occurs in Stuart, Florida, the insurance company becomes an inevitable party in the claim process. This is because insurance companies cover the cost and settlement associated with personal injury claims.
The third-party insurance adjuster will reach out to the victim to give a recorded statement about the car accident. Then, they will investigate the insurance claim to determine the extent of liability. They also review the accident case by speaking with other victims, researching records, and inspecting damaged properties.
Giving a recorded statement to the insurance company may seem harmless. However, the statement’s ulterior purposes may not be in the victim’s best interest. An accident often leaves a victim in a state of shock, confusion, severe pain, or with prescribed medication. Insurance adjusters can use this vulnerability to their advantage. This is because they are more focused on limiting their liability.
